Transaction 577299b1f24c819f12e67c752996d3c2ffced11ddbe581890c11d3652fe73fab

2 Input
1 Outputs
  • 577299b1f24c819f12e67c752996d3c2ffced11ddbe581890c11d3652fe73fab:0
  • value  125415
    address  3PtrZkXojv3X1cCH5uCbh7UNDvqYuBVtft